The Philadelphia Quartermaster Depot, often referenced as QMISC Philadelphia QM Depot, traces its origins to the early 19th century, playing a pivotal role in supplying the U.S. Army with uniforms, equipment, and other essential materials. During the Civil War and both World Wars, the depot became a logistical hub, rapidly expanding its operations to meet the demands of mobilizing and sustaining large military forces. Its strategic location in Philadelphia provided vital access to railroads, ports, and industrial resources, enabling efficient distribution nationwide and overseas. Over its long history, the depot contributed significantly to military readiness until its functions were gradually consolidated and phased out in the late 20th century.
